NOTE: The VLS operating system contains all the hardware device drivers, firmware, and utilities required to operate the VLS. To re-install the operating system: 1. Connect a keyboard to the keyboard connector. See Rear panel components. 2. Connect a monitor to the video connector. See Rear panel components. 3. Insert the VLS Quick Restore CD into the CD-ROM or DVD-CD drive. The VLS Quick Restore CD auto starts. 4. Press R on the keyboard to start the re-installation. The re-installation takes 30 minutes or less to complete. The screen may freeze during the last 10 minutes of the re-installation. This is normal. The VLS Quick Restore CD is ejected and the system reboots when the re-installation is complete. 5. When restoring the primary node, restore the configuration settings. See Restoring the configuration settings. 6. When restoring the primary node, if one or more capacity licenses had been added to the VLS, re-install the VLS capacity license(s).
